🐾The Humboldt marten is a rare Lazarus species — declared extinct in 1946 but rediscovered in 1996 after being missing for 50 years. Today, it remains critically endangered, surviving only in the old-growth forests of Northern California and Oregon. The Asiatic cheetah 🐆 is a critically endangered subspecies found only in Iran. Fewer than 50 remain in the wild. It lives in deserts and plateaus, hunting gazelles and wild sheep. Red_book 🌿 Slender-billed Curlew (Numenius tenuirostris) 🌿 This rare bird species is on the brink of extinction (CR). Distribution: Southern Aral region (migration), Western Siberia (breeding), Mediterranean countries (wintering). Habitat: flat wetlands with marshy shores and shallow areas. Population: currently less than 50 individuals worldwide; in the 1980–90s, there were 316–326. Lifestyle: spring migration — March–April, autumn migration — August–September; feeds on aquatic invertebrates. Threats: habitat loss and changes in natural environments. Conservation: hunting is prohibited; protected in the “Sudochye Lakes System” state reserve. 🦤 The Great Bustard Has Returned to Uzbekistan In early November 2025, one of the rarest birds of Uzbekistan and the world — the Great Bustard — returned to the country for wintering. 📍 More than 50 individuals are currently staying in the Farish and Gallaorol districts of Jizzakh region. Some of these critically endangered birds have even been captured on video — truly rare and valuable footage. As part of the Great Bustard conservation program in Uzbekistan, the Bird Protection Society of Uzbekistan continues to: conduct weekly monitoring of the population and threats; hold educational talks in schools of Jizzakh region; organize public hearings with active hunters to prevent illegal hunting of bustards. ❗️ Important to note: The Bird Protection Society of Uzbekistan is the only public environmental organization in the country that consistently advocates for the protection of the Great Bustard — the largest and rarest bird species in Uzbekistan. Axolotls, also known as Ambystoma mexicanum, get their name from the Aztec language Nahuatl, meaning "water monster" or "water god." According to legend, they are the earthly form of Xolotl, the Aztec god who transformed into a salamander to avoid sacrifice. These creatures are famous for regenerating limbs, hearts, and even parts of their brains. They stay in their juvenile form for life, a trait called neoteny. In the wild, axolotls are critically endangered, with fewer than 1,000 left in Mexico’s Xochimilco and Chalco lakes. Habitat loss, pollution, and invasive species like tilapia are major threats.
